Fire Rips Through Old School Site

Emergency teams scrambled to the former Moira House school on Upper Carlisle Road at 5.40pm on Sunday evening after witnesses spotted a massive fire. Firefighters quickly doused the flames, and luckily, no one was injured. But detectives say the fire was no accident — they suspect arson.

Four Boys in Police Sights Over Suspicious Activity

Officers are desperately tracking down four boys seen entering the deserted building earlier that afternoon. Police believe their movements could crack the case wide open.

Asbestos Fears Spark Health Warning

Worries about asbestos exposure have rattled locals. A multi-agency spokesperson reassured the public:

“Our information indicates there is no known asbestos in the affected areas. While this makes the risk of asbestos exposure very unlikely, we understand people may still feel concerned.”

Smoke from the fire can cause coughing, sore throats, wheezing, and eye irritation. Asthmatics are urged to keep inhalers handy. Anyone feeling unwell after being near the fire should consult their GP or call NHS 111.

Emergency services stress: dial 999 immediately if you experience chest pain or severe breathing problems.
